An easy and healthy slow cooker chicken recipe perfect for busy weeknights. Tender, flavorful, and customizable with your favorite veggies and spices.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 lbs boneless, skinless chicken breasts or thighs
  • 1 cup low-sodium chicken broth
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• 2 carrots, sliced
  • 2 celery stalks, chopped
  • 1 red b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 tsp dried thyme
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• ½ tsp salt
  • ¼ tsp black pepper
  • 2 tbsp chopped parsley (for garnish)
  • Optional: ½ cup plain Greek yogurt or light cream cheese (for creamy version)

Instructions

  1. Place carrots, celery, onions, and bell pepper at the bottom of the crockpot.
  2. Lay chicken on top and sprinkle with thyme, paprika, salt, and pepper.
  3. Add minced garlic and pour in chicken broth.
  4. Cover and cook on LOW for 6–7 hours or HIGH for 3–4 hours, until chicken is tender.
  5. Shred chicken in the pot or remove and chop, then return to the sauce.
  6. Stir in optional Greek yogurt or cream cheese for a creamy texture.
  7. Garnish with parsley and serve over rice, quinoa, or greens.

Notes

  • Add 1–2 tbsp lemon juice at the end for brightness.
  • Store leftovers in the fridge for 4 days or freeze for 3 months.
  • Swap chicken with chickpeas for a vegetarian version.
